> From all I've read, it's not as simple as that. The new
processors have two modes, one high-power and one low-power,
between which they switch constantly. Thus, any battery time
indicator on the new Pro will almost certainly be inaccurate,
because a few minutes at high power could be the same as a longer
time at low power. This would cause the time estimate to be all
over the place. Apple therefore decided to just show you the
remaining percentage, just like it's done on iOS since the beginning.

>>>>>>> Hey everyone, going to cover a few different things in
one message. First, as the subject says, has anyone else had
issues reading the time remaining or percentage of a macbook
battery in sierra? This happens on my 2010 macbook, and my girl
friend's 2015 macbook pro. While in the status menus, moving left
and right with the voiceover cursor allows you to get to the
battery item, but it just says battery or something similar, no
time remaining or percentage, this happens whether the option to
show the percentage is checked or not in the menu. The only way I
know of to get around this is to check it in the energy saver
settings in system preferences. Interestingly, you can no longer
use the regular arrow keys to navigate the status menus, you must
use VO navigation. I don't mind this, actually it's more
consistent this way since before, the arrow keys only navigated
built in items like wifi or the battery, third party items such
as dropbox always have required VO navigation to access them.
